Job description
Interpret blueprints, drawings, and measurements to plan layouts. Weld small and large components such as copper plumbing, beams, and pipelines. Use specialized machinery for industrial welding and oversee machines that perform the same job. Maintain and repair all machinery. Assess welded surfaces, structures and components to identify errors. Follow and enforce strict safety regulations such as wearing heat-resistant gloves, protective masks, and safety shoes. Monitor machinery for appropriate usage and temperature. Weld components in flat, vertical, and overhead positions.
